Magnetic Therapy Basics: Understanding how magnetic fields are believed to affect the body and potentially alleviate arthritis symptoms

Magnetic therapy operates on the principle that magnetic fields can influence biological processes within the body. Proponents of this alternative treatment believe that magnets can help to alleviate pain, reduce inflammation, and improve circulation, which could potentially provide relief for individuals suffering from arthritis. The theory suggests that the magnetic fields interact with the body's own electromagnetic fields, promoting a balance that supports healing and reduces discomfort.

One of the key concepts in magnetic therapy is the idea that different types of magnetic fields can have varying effects on the body. For instance, static magnets, which are commonly used in magnetic jewelry like rings, are thought to provide a constant, gentle stimulation that may help to manage pain and inflammation over time. On the other hand, pulsed electromagnetic fields (PEMFs) are believed to have a more dynamic effect, potentially enhancing the body's natural healing processes by mimicking the electromagnetic signals that occur naturally within the body.

While the scientific evidence supporting the effectiveness of magnetic therapy for arthritis is limited and often inconclusive, many individuals report anecdotal benefits from using magnetic rings and other magnetic devices. These benefits may include reduced pain, improved joint mobility, and a decrease in the need for pain medications. However, it is important to note that the placebo effect may play a significant role in these reported benefits, as the belief in the effectiveness of a treatment can often influence a person's perception of their symptoms.

Critics of magnetic therapy argue that there is insufficient scientific evidence to support its use as a treatment for arthritis and other conditions. They point out that many studies on the subject have been small, poorly designed, or lacking in control groups, making it difficult to draw definitive conclusions about the therapy's effectiveness. Additionally, there are concerns about the potential risks associated with magnetic therapy, such as interference with medical devices like pacemakers and the possibility of magnetic fields affecting the body's natural electromagnetic balance in unforeseen ways.

Scientific Evidence: Examining research studies and clinical trials on the effectiveness of magnetic rings for arthritis pain relief

Several research studies and clinical trials have been conducted to investigate the effectiveness of magnetic rings for arthritis pain relief. A 2002 study published in the British Medical Journal found that magnetic bracelets were no more effective than placebo in reducing pain and improving function in patients with osteoarthritis of the knee. Similarly, a 2007 study in the Journal of Rheumatology concluded that magnetic therapy had no significant effect on pain, stiffness, or physical function in patients with rheumatoid arthritis.

However, not all studies have yielded negative results. A 2011 systematic review and meta-analysis published in the journal Arthritis Research & Therapy found that magnetic therapy may be effective in reducing pain and improving function in patients with osteoarthritis, although the authors noted that the quality of the evidence was low and further research was needed. Additionally, a 2014 study in the Journal of Alternative and Complementary Medicine found that magnetic therapy was effective in reducing pain and improving quality of life in patients with fibromyalgia.

One of the challenges in evaluating the effectiveness of magnetic rings for arthritis pain relief is the variability in the design and quality of the studies. Some studies have used small sample sizes, while others have had methodological flaws that may have biased the results. Furthermore, the mechanisms by which magnetic therapy may work are not fully understood, which makes it difficult to design studies that can adequately test its effectiveness.

Types of Magnetic Rings: Exploring different designs, materials, and strengths of magnetic rings available for arthritis sufferers

Magnetic rings for arthritis come in various designs, each catering to different preferences and needs. The most common types include full-finger rings, which cover the entire finger, and half-finger rings, which leave the fingertip exposed. Full-finger rings are often preferred for their comprehensive coverage, while half-finger rings allow for better dexterity. Additionally, there are adjustable magnetic rings with a sliding mechanism, enabling users to customize the fit according to their finger size and swelling conditions.

The materials used in magnetic rings also vary, with some made from metals like copper or stainless steel, and others from non-metallic materials such as silicone or fabric. Metal rings are typically more durable and have a stronger magnetic field, while non-metallic rings are lighter and more comfortable for extended wear. The choice of material can also influence the aesthetic appeal of the ring, with metal rings often having a more traditional look and non-metallic rings offering a more modern and discreet appearance.

The strength of the magnetic field in these rings is another important factor to consider. Magnetic field strength is measured in Gauss, and rings can range from low-strength (around 1,000 Gauss) to high-strength (up to 12,000 Gauss or more). While there is no definitive evidence that stronger magnetic fields are more effective for arthritis, some users may prefer higher-strength rings in hopes of experiencing greater relief. It is essential to note that magnetic rings should not be used by individuals with pacemakers or other implanted medical devices, as the magnetic field can interfere with their function.
